Centre for Health Care and Sport

  • Address: 14 (B’) Ivana Franka St., Berehove
  • Owner: Ferenc Rakoczi II Transcarpathian Hungarian University (UR)
  • Total Area: 2,186.3 m2
  • Number of Floors: 2
  • Number of Rooms: 28

The building, originally constructed in the 1980s, was purchased by the institution in 2016 to be converted into a sports facility. Prior to the reconstruction, the building occupied a 0.7736-hectare plot of land and had a total area of only 637 $m^2$. Following the extensive renovation, the now two-story building houses two gymnasiums, a dance hall, an aerobics room, and specialized facilities for training nurses and caregivers.

The Centre for Health Care and Sport was officially opened on June 21, 2019, having been established with the support of the Government of Hungary and the State Secretariat for National Policy.
